Try it, bub, she thought wryly.  But when he said it, despite herself, she couldn't stop the flicker of a smile that appeared.

It faded pretty quick when he launched into a very, very careful deep dive of everything.  She bit her cheek so she wouldn't be tempted to interrupt, though internally she did scream once or twice because he was just so careful.  Initially it made her feel like he thought she was crazy, about to go off loose just because he got one thing wrong, and it didn't help with the ever-present irritation.  (Funny enough, this kinda proved the point had merit?)  But as he went, she stopped paying attention to that because she was noting all of the things he was saying.

The trip she could dismiss offhand.  She'd been pissed about it at first, but when it came down to it, the stupid coconut had been what incited her to run.  She was glad he knew it now, and glad she'd managed to say it, but regardless it was over and done.  He hadn't thought to ask, but maybe next time he would.

The den was harder.  Nothing he said was a surprise to her, and she took it completely in stride because it was what she'd already assumed.  She'd apparently known before he did that it would be a problem.  She just hadn't known how severe that problem would be, and instead had allowed herself to get her hopes up.  Maybe that was why it hurt so much when it hadn't gone over nearly the way she planned.  While he started going into how much of an idiot he was, and laughing at himself (thankfully he could at least do that), Fennec smiled a little more genuinely, but distantly.  She probably owed one more explanation, then.

I figured you would be.  Well, I guessed.  She felt this weird sadness as she thought back on it.  Leta was probably well moved in now.  You didn't get to see it, but the ceiling was stone, so there was no way it'd collapse.  And I dug it way bigger, and way deeper, than the other one.  I got as close to feeling like it wasn't underground as I could.  The tension left her shoulders and Fennec sat down.  I've never given anyone a gift before, and honestly, I shoulda suspected I'd be shit at them.  That's what it was supposed to be.  I was pretty upset when you couldn't even look at it.  I figured it wasn't your fault, but... no, I didn't go after you.

Maybe he was right in being mad about that, but she didn't know if even knowing that, she'd have been able to.  He'd been wrapped up in dealing with his own shit, but in doing so, he hadn't really taken into account how his shit had made her feel.  And as much as she'd love to be a big enough person to toss her own issues aside and run to help with his, that was definitely not her.

Guess that makes both of us stupid though, she said finally, with a light huff.  Because when I came back, and the thing was gone?  I figured you'd had enough fuck-ups.  She hadn't been able to think of any other rational reason why he would have taken back something he'd given her.  There'd been other factors, sure, but that was the main reason she'd left.  She'd come there because of him, and if he had been through with her, she didn't want to stay.  She didn't think she could handle staying.  Is it stupid that I really wish you still had it?  

Much as she insisted she hadn't asked for it, and would have rather had the trip, thinking about it being lost in the river made her extremely sad.  It had been a really neat find, and she could have really used it.
